Pine Cliff Energy Ltd (PNE) — Defensive Interval Ratio

Latest as of March 2026: 139 days

Pine Cliff Energy Ltd (PNE) has a Defensive Interval Ratio of 139 days as of March 2026. Defensive assets of CA$19.51 Million (cash CA$-, short-term investments CA$-, receivables CA$19.51 Million) cover 139 days of daily cash needs of CA$140.19K/day.
